    PATNA: Prime Minister Narendra Modi on Tuesday said his mother was abused from the RJD-Congress platform in Bihar.“In the state of Bihar, known for its rich tradition, something happened a few days ago that I could not have imagined. My mother was abused from the RJD-Congress platform in Bihar.

    “This insult is not just against my mother, but against all the mothers, sisters, and daughters of the country. I know how much this has hurt you all, and how much it has pained every mother in Bihar. I understand that the pain in my heart is shared by the people of Bihar as well,” Modi said.
